Prioritize Your Google My Business Profile
Ensure your GMB listing is fully optimized—accurate name, address, and phone number consistent across all listings. Add high-quality photos that showcase your business authentically. During a quick audit, I once noticed missing categories and outdated contact info on my client’s profile, which was tanking the ranking. After correcting this, we saw a noticeable bump in local visibility within weeks. Regularly update your profile with new photos and posts to stay active and relevant, signaling to Google that your business is thriving and trustworthy. Build Local Entity Signals Fast
Register your business on reputable local directories—Yelp, Bing Places, and industry-specific sites. Consistency is key: your Name, Address, Phone (NAP) must match exactly everywhere. I worked with a client who neglected citation consistency; once we cleaned this up, their map rankings improved notably. Use schema markup on your website for local business details to enhance search engines’ understanding of your entity, which is increasingly critical in 2026. Optimize Business Categorization and Attributes
Assign the most relevant primary and secondary categories to your GMB profile to match your services exactly. For example, a coffee shop should select “Coffee & Tea Shop” rather than a broad category like “Restaurant.” Add attributes that reflect your offerings—like “Wi-Fi,” “Wheelchair Accessible,” or “Outdoor Seating.” I once mistakenly used generic categories, which limited my visibility for niche searches. When I refined categories and added specific attributes, my profile started appearing for more precise local queries, driving quality traffic. Leverage Photos, Videos, and User Content
Consistently upload fresh, high-quality images showcasing your location, products, and team. Encourage satisfied customers to leave positive reviews and add photos of their experience. During my campaign, adding pictures of staff and community involvement significantly increased engagement and improved rankings. Videos are also booming in importance—short clips of your shop, services, or customer testimonials can make your listing stand out. Use captions and geotags on all media. Focus on Local Backlinks and Content
Build backlinks from Oklahoma-based sites—local newspapers, chambers of commerce, or industry blogs. Guest posting on local sites not only garners backlinks but also signals local relevance. When I secured a guest post on a regional business blog, my client’s profile better matched local intent and climbed higher in maps rankings. Additionally, creating locally focused content on your website, such as Tulsa-specific service pages, signals to Google your regional authority. Remember, backlinks from authoritative local sources are more valuable than generic links; they act as votes of trust specifically within your geographic area. Enhance Mobile Experience and User Behavior
Since most local searches happen on mobile, ensure your website is fast-loading, mobile-friendly, and easy to navigate. I once optimized a client’s site speed from 8 seconds to under 3 seconds by compressing images and leveraging browser caching. This technical tweak led to a marked improvement in user engagement and a boost in map rankings. Additionally, monitor user behavior metrics like bounce rate and dwell time—positive signals indicating your site provides value. How do I maintain my Google Maps rankings over time?
Consistency and precise tools are vital for sustained success in Oklahoma’s competitive local SEO landscape, especially as algorithms become more sophisticated. I rely heavily on Moz Local for managing NAP citations because it automatically syncs your business info across hundreds of directories, reducing discrepancies that can harm rankings. Additionally, I use BrightLocal’s Rank Tracker to monitor fluctuations daily, allowing me to spot drops early and act swiftly before client reputations are impacted. For managing reviews and engagement, Podium streamlines communication and prompts satisfied customers to share their experiences, which is essential for long-term trust signals.
